Output d84d266277d16707f4f91f52df597b923b866966f5f839e6951ff365cde61e65:9

value
56377963
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 28a2c1affc779b66aca6257ea72afbf0fc14d331 OP_EQUALVERIFY OP_CHECKSIG
address
14hs1CZxUafPTU2x5fGWTryMWHenUQrGU6
transaction
d84d266277d16707f4f91f52df597b923b866966f5f839e6951ff365cde61e65
spent
true